Types of Intellectual Property Protectable Assets in Mining Activities

In the mining sector, various intellectual property rights protect critical assets that foster innovation and competitiveness. These assets include patents, trade secrets, trademarks, copyrights, and database rights.

Patents are fundamental for safeguarding new mining technologies and processes, granting exclusive rights for a limited period. Trade secrets protect proprietary knowledge, such as extraction techniques, without public disclosure.

Trademarks establish brand identity for mining companies or products, enhancing market recognition. Copyrights cover creative works related to mining, including technical documentation and marketing materials. Database rights safeguard valuable compilations of geological data and resource information.

Legal Frameworks Governing Mining Sector Intellectual Property Rights

Legal frameworks governing mining sector intellectual property rights are primarily rooted in international treaties, regional agreements, and national laws. These standards establish the criteria for protecting innovations, data, and resources within the mining industry. They also set procedures for granting patents, trademarks, and trade secrets related to mining technologies and practices.

At the international level, conventions such as the World Trade Organization’s Agreement on Trade-Related Aspects of Intellectual Property Rights (TRIPS) play a central role. TRIPS harmonizes IP protection requirements across member states, facilitating cross-border enforcement and innovation sharing. Regional agreements, like the Eurasian Patent Convention, further tailor legal protections suited to specific jurisdictions.

National legislation varies significantly, with each country implementing its own laws and regulations. These laws define the scope of protectable mining innovations, enforcement mechanisms, and dispute resolution methods. Patentability of Mining Technologies and Processes

Patentability of mining technologies and processes hinges on several key criteria established by international and national laws. To qualify for a patent, innovations must be novel, non-obvious, and have industrial applicability. This ensures that only truly inventive mining techniques are protected.

Typically, patent applications in the mining sector require detailed disclosures of the technology or process, demonstrating how they differ from existing methods. Examples include new extraction methods, drilling techniques, or data-analysis tools that enhance efficiency or safety.

Regulatory frameworks often exclude certain natural principles, abstract ideas, or discoveries from patent protection, focusing protection on the technical and inventive aspects. This means that new mining equipment or processes that significantly improve an existing technology are prioritized for patent rights.

The patenting process involves rigorous examination and classification, ensuring that only genuine innovations receive protection. This legal safeguard encourage investments in mining research and helps secure competitive advantages within a highly specialized sector.

Enforcement Mechanisms and Dispute Resolution for Mining IP Rights

Effective enforcement mechanisms are fundamental to protecting mining sector intellectual property rights. They include administrative procedures, such as patent office actions, and judicial remedies like injunctions, damages, and criminal sanctions. These frameworks ensure rights holders can act decisively against infringements.

Dispute resolution methods play a vital role in maintaining a balanced legal environment. Arbitration and mediation are often preferred for their confidentiality, speed, and international enforceability, especially in cross-border disputes involving mining technology. Formal litigation may be necessary when disputes involve complex legal issues or require authoritative rulings.

International cooperation is increasingly important for effective enforcement of mining sector intellectual property rights. Multilateral treaties and harmonization efforts, like the Patent Cooperation Treaty or the Agreement on Trade-Related Aspects of Intellectual Property Rights (TRIPS), facilitate dispute resolution. They enable rights holders to navigate different legal systems efficiently and secure consistent protection globally.
